Sweet 16 for Bay High Basketball Team

The Bay High basketball team continued on the path of one of the greatest seasons in school history by claiming a Div. II district championship last weekend.

The Rockets, now 22-3 overall, outfought a game Keystone squad on Saturday night, 71-59, to capture the school’s first district crown since 1993.DSC_6101-82

Bay now becomes a member of the state’s elite Sweet 16 and will play in a regional semifinals game against Napoleon Thursday at 8 p.m. at Bowling Green.

Bay’s fast pace and scrappy defense neutralized the 19-6 Keystone team’s bid for an upset last weekend. Bay was the tournament’s top seed, and Keystone second, but Bay’s defense and pressure forced Keystone turnovers and set up the potent Rocket offense time and again. Bay built a lead as large as 52-30 in the third quarter. Keystone, staging a late comeback, sliced the deficit to 8, but it was too little, too late against the deep and talented Rockets.DSC_5761-33

Bay’s depth and balance is easily seen in the box score as  junior Jack Jelen paced the attack with 19 points, eight from a perfect night at the free throw line. Senior John Koz, now Bay’s career scoring record holder, added 16. Sophomore R.J. Sunahara added 14 and freshman Erik Painter canned 11.
